Beberapa waktu lalu, guild kami merancang sebuah aktivitas insentif on-chain, tapi nyaris gagal gara-gara biaya Gas. Sebenarnya skemanya cukup sederhana—pemain yang menyelesaikan misi tertentu di dalam game bisa dapat reward token. Tapi waktu benar-benar harus mengirim data progres masing-masing pemain ke blockchain untuk divalidasi, kami syok: biaya untuk satu kali verifikasi hampir sama besar dengan jumlah hadiahnya.
Kegagalan ini bikin saya mulai mikir, gimana caranya guild game besar bisa bikin ribuan sampai puluhan ribu pemain ikut misi on-chain barengan, tapi biayanya tetap bisa ditekan. Setelah riset ke sana-sini, baru sadar ternyata mereka memang nggak pernah niat masukin semua data game ke blockchain.
Inti idenya sebenarnya cuma delapan kata: perhitungan off-chain, pembuktian on-chain.
Contohnya begini—server game itu ibarat guru yang memeriksa ujian, mencatat berapa lama kamu mengerjakan soal, mana yang benar, dsb. Cara tradisional itu kayak ngirim rekaman CCTV seluruh ruang ujian ke publik, transparan sih, tapi biaya bandwidth dan storage bisa bikin pusing.
Cara pintarnya gimana? Guru selesai memeriksa, cukup kirim nilai akhir dan beberapa bukti kunci (misalnya kartu ujian yang sudah ditandatangani) ke blockchain. Di on-chain, cuma bukti ringkas itu yang diverifikasi, proses di tengah nggak perlu diurus. Jadi hasilnya tetap bisa dipercaya, tapi biaya interaksi bisa dipangkas habis-habisan.
Logika ini buat pemain biasa nggak terasa bedanya—main tetap main, reward tetap dapat. Tapi buat pembangun, ini benar-benar solusi infrastruktur Web3 game yang bisa direalisasikan. Tentu saja, keamanan proses off-chain dan kredibilitas server masih jadi titik risiko yang harus terus diawasi.
Lihat Asli
Halaman ini mungkin berisi konten pihak ketiga, yang disediakan untuk tujuan informasi saja (bukan pernyataan/jaminan) dan tidak boleh dianggap sebagai dukungan terhadap pandangannya oleh Gate, atau sebagai nasihat keuangan atau profesional. Lihat Penafian untuk detailnya.
10 Suka
Hadiah
10
8
Posting ulang
Bagikan
Komentar
0/400
rekt_but_vibing
· 1jam yang lalu
Ha, ini alasan kenapa kita kemarin kena gas fee tinggi, ternyata mereka memang sudah paham cara mainnya.
Perhitungan off-chain dengan pembuktian on-chain, terdengar sederhana, tapi pelaksanaannya tetap harus percaya sama server, gimana caranya supaya nggak kena rug di bagian ini?
Reward besar harus di-on-chain secara bertahap, kalau nggak bakal jebol lagi biayanya.
Wah, akhirnya paham juga gimana guild besar bisa bertahan, optimasi biaya mereka benar-benar maksimal.
Intinya tetap di batch processing, verifikasi satu per satu memang berat banget.
Solusi ini benar-benar penyelamat buat guild kecil, kalau nggak, mana sanggup main.
Lihat AsliBalas0
ImpermanentLossFan
· 11jam yang lalu
Saya juga pernah rugi karena biaya gas sebelumnya, benar-benar parah. Tapi konsep komputasi off-chain ini memang cerdas, cuma servernya harus benar-benar diamankan.
Lihat AsliBalas0
Degen4Breakfast
· 12-05 16:47
Perhitungan off-chain, pembuktian on-chain, inilah cara yang benar untuk melakukannya.
Lihat AsliBalas0
SchrodingerAirdrop
· 12-05 16:45
Pembagian tugas antara off-chain dan on-chain ini memang luar biasa, menghemat gas berarti menghemat uang.
Lihat AsliBalas0
SighingCashier
· 12-05 16:45
Inilah cara yang benar, pemisahan antara off-chain dan on-chain seharusnya memang dilakukan seperti ini.
Lihat AsliBalas0
nft_widow
· 12-05 16:45
Benar, biaya gas ini benar-benar bikin sakit hati, satu acara hampir sia-sia kerjaannya.
Konsep komputasi off-chain ini memang cerdas, kalau tidak memang sulit direalisasikan.
Kalau dibahasakan dengan baik itu optimasi, kalau dibahasakan dengan jujur tetap saja main-main kepercayaan.
Inilah kenapa saya selalu merasa game on-chain masih jauh dari adopsi skala besar.
Desentralisasi dan biaya selalu seperti buah simalakama, tidak bisa dapat dua-duanya.
Tapi ngomong-ngomong, pengelolaan bagian off-chain itu harus sangat ketat, kalau tidak bisa bikin rugi orang banyak.
Lihat saja guild yang memang terpercaya juga mainnya seperti ini, cukup realistis.
Lihat AsliBalas0
StealthDeployer
· 12-05 16:32
Saya sudah menggunakan cara berpikir ini sejak lama, pemisahan on-chain dan off-chain benar-benar penyelamat, kalau tidak, guild kecil sudah lama bangkrut.
Lihat AsliBalas0
GasFeeGazer
· 12-05 16:32
Ini baru solusi yang pragmatis, tidak harus semuanya dicatat di blockchain, kan?
Beberapa waktu lalu, guild kami merancang sebuah aktivitas insentif on-chain, tapi nyaris gagal gara-gara biaya Gas. Sebenarnya skemanya cukup sederhana—pemain yang menyelesaikan misi tertentu di dalam game bisa dapat reward token. Tapi waktu benar-benar harus mengirim data progres masing-masing pemain ke blockchain untuk divalidasi, kami syok: biaya untuk satu kali verifikasi hampir sama besar dengan jumlah hadiahnya.
Kegagalan ini bikin saya mulai mikir, gimana caranya guild game besar bisa bikin ribuan sampai puluhan ribu pemain ikut misi on-chain barengan, tapi biayanya tetap bisa ditekan. Setelah riset ke sana-sini, baru sadar ternyata mereka memang nggak pernah niat masukin semua data game ke blockchain.
Inti idenya sebenarnya cuma delapan kata: perhitungan off-chain, pembuktian on-chain.
Contohnya begini—server game itu ibarat guru yang memeriksa ujian, mencatat berapa lama kamu mengerjakan soal, mana yang benar, dsb. Cara tradisional itu kayak ngirim rekaman CCTV seluruh ruang ujian ke publik, transparan sih, tapi biaya bandwidth dan storage bisa bikin pusing.
Cara pintarnya gimana? Guru selesai memeriksa, cukup kirim nilai akhir dan beberapa bukti kunci (misalnya kartu ujian yang sudah ditandatangani) ke blockchain. Di on-chain, cuma bukti ringkas itu yang diverifikasi, proses di tengah nggak perlu diurus. Jadi hasilnya tetap bisa dipercaya, tapi biaya interaksi bisa dipangkas habis-habisan.
Logika ini buat pemain biasa nggak terasa bedanya—main tetap main, reward tetap dapat. Tapi buat pembangun, ini benar-benar solusi infrastruktur Web3 game yang bisa direalisasikan. Tentu saja, keamanan proses off-chain dan kredibilitas server masih jadi titik risiko yang harus terus diawasi.